tctl login

tctl login

Configures the credentials for the given user

Synopsis

Configures the credentials for the given user.

This command will exchange the given credentials for an access token that can be stored in the configuration profile. If the credentials are not provided as arguments to the login command, an interactive prompt will ask for all required information.

Credentials can also be configured in the following environment variables:

  • TCTL_LOGIN_ORG
  • TCTL_LOGIN_TENANT
  • TCTL_LOGIN_USERNAME
  • TCTL_LOGIN_PASSWORD

The token exchange is done using the cluster settings defined in the current profile, and the user information will be stored in a user with the name <cluster name>-<username>. This user will be also set as the user for the current profile.

tctl login [flags]

Options

      --org string        Name of the organization
--tenant string Name of the tenant
--username string Username
--password string Password
-h, --help help for login

Options inherited from parent commands

      --config string    Path to the config file to use. Can also be
specified via TCTL_CONFIG env variable. This flag
takes precedence over the env variable.
--debug Print debug messages for all requests and responses
-p, --profile string Use specific profile (default "default")
